Annual Blackpool Congress:

This year hosted by BDF and held in a beautiful atmospheric Spanish Hall . A wide spectrum of top-tier professionals giving their expertise and sharing their views and knowledge during 2 days is a big insight to witness for all dance lovers. It’s a must go-to event!


We are grateful and thrilled to be amongst those pros to open the Congress with our first lecture on Saturday morning with title : “One Point Wonder” in Paso Doble, discovering this dance as internal body dance by feeling the pulse & moving with pulse, as a heart-beat.

And more exciting was to conclude the Congress on Sunday with one & only - a legend, a champion of the Golden Era, Mr.Alan Fletcher. The lecture was about the essential fundamentals in dance. We were glad to assist and support Alan’s lecture , demonstrating those vital points in the dance -Jive. And of course, the girls ( Marina & Sasha Kondrashova) taking a dance with Alan himself, with a famous section from Latin Fantasy! The audience thoroughly enjoyed it, so did we.


And the day did not stop there and we are moving to the exciting Saturday -Sunday Team Match .

As always there are 4 teams competing and fighting for the Title : Great Britain, USA, Europe, Rest of the World.

Being in the team of Great Britain together with Dusan &Valeria, Kyle & Alisa and Adelmo & Leah leaded by our charismatic team captain, Mr. John Byrnes together his beautiful wife -Jane Byrnes, gave us another great experience!


The team have chosen an epoch of 50s style ( whether from dancing era or from a life) in colours combination Red with Black accessories and looked in the most stylish way! The GB team was very close to take the team match trophy this year, but Europe had their night! We congratulate team Europe for being the strong opponent.


It was a very excited team match as all teams becoming very innovative and artistic in their approach – we feel it makes it look more interesting for the audience to watch.

We also have said goodbye and congratulate our team member with their beautiful retirement Walz – Kyle & Alisa. We had the most lovely memories and time shared together with them for the past few years of Team Matches. We wish to Kyle & Alisa all good in the new chapter of their lives.


It comes to a Sunday Cocktail Party where all teams preparing their fun performances-presentation.

This year team GB haven’t chosen a fun performance, but performance in a memory of an iconic dancer, mentor, friend, a teacher who has recently unexpectedly passed away . And of course some our team members were very attached to this person and had their personal connections. We felt like we wanted to dedicated this number to one and only Mr. Andrew Sinkinson who we all miss greatly.. The Empress Ballroom has always been his place ..where the dancer shines.

Andrew had a great impact on many people from our industry in many different ways, so we recreated Andrew’s favorite circle of friendship, where we stood together holding each others hands and dancing in a circle with all people in the room. This was “Sweet Caroline” … Andrew loved this song and created a tradition to gather people after work , groups, parties for this dance in circle to remind us all: we are friends … It was very touching moment and energy in the Empress Ballroom was devine.. In loving memory of Andrew.
